What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:
Choosing the best robot vacuum includes more than simply choosing the flashiest design. Thoroughly consider the following elements to guarantee you select a gadget that genuinely fulfills your needs and provides worth:
Budget: Robot vacuums vary in rate from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Determine your budget plan upfront to narrow down your options. Remember that greater cost points frequently correlate with more innovative functions like smarter navigation, stronger suction, and self-emptying capabil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or types in your home. Houses with mostly tough floors might take advantage of designs with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ets require strong suction power and brush roll designs engineered for carpet cleaning. Some models are flexible and carry out well on both difficult floorings and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a typical cleaning difficulty. If you have family pets, search for robot vacuums specifically created to deal with pet hair. These typically feature t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and effective filtering systems to capture allergens.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with multiple levels may require rob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to ensure complete cleaning protection. Residences with complex designs and many challenges will take advantage of innovative nav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you desire app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ant combination? Smart includes boost benefit and customisation however typically come at a greater cost.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ic designs typically utilize random bounce navigation, which is less effective but can still clean up successfully in smaller sized areas.Systematic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More innovative models use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se systematically. This leads to more effective c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the ability to set virtual limits.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power identifies how successfully a robot vacuum gets dirt and debris. Greater suction is typically better, specifically for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life dictates the length of time the robot vacuum can run on a single charge. Consider the size of your home and pick a model with adequate battery life to clean it successfully. Automatic charging is a standard feature, where the robot go back to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ium models come with self-emptying bases. These bases immediately draw the dust and debris from the robot's dustbin into a larger, disposable bag, substantially lowering the frequency of manual dustbin emptying and boosting benefit.Noise Level: Robot vacuums differ in noise output. If sound sensitivity is a concern, search for models promoted as quiet operating.

Tips for Getting one of the most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:
To guarantee your robot vacuum operates successfully and effectively for several years to come, think about these useful tips: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floors by removing loose cables, little toys, and other barriers that could hinder its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.Routine Maintenance: Empty the dustbin routinely (or less often with self-emptying models), clean the brushes and filters as recommended by the maker, and inspect for any obstructions or wear and tear.Set Up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ling function to set your robot vacuum to tidy automatically at practical times, such as when you are at work or asleep.Use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ning features, use them to prevent the robot from going into specific areas or to target cleaning to certain spaces.Display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um in action to ensure it is cleaning successfully and browsing appropriately. Attend to any issues quickly.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connectivity, ensure you keep the firmware and app upgraded to benefit from the most current features and efficiency enhancements.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the investment?A: For busy people and those seeking to lower their cleaning workload, robot vacuums can be a beneficial investment. They automate a tiresome chore and can preserve a regularly c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ums change traditional vacuums completely?A: Robot vacuums are excellent for regular maintenance cleaning but may not entirely change standard vacuums for deep cleaning tasks,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Lots of users discover they supplement their robot vacuum with a conventional vacuum for more extensive cleaning.Q: How often should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is ideal for keeping a consistently tidy home, particularly in families with pets or children. However, you can change the frequency based on your requirements and family tra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ums work on carpets and carpets?A: Yes, numerous robot vacuums are designed to work on both hard floors and carpets. Search for models with strong suction and brush rolls created for carpet cleaning performance.Q: How long do robot vacuums generally last?A: With correct maintenance, an excellent qu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, normally 3-5 years or longer depending on use and brand.Q: Are robot vacuums noisy?A: Robot vacuums usually produce less sound than traditional vacuums, but noise levels differ in between models. Some models are particularly developed for quieter operation.Q: What is the distinction between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) utilizes lasers to create an in-depth map of your home, using exact navigation and effective cleaning courses. Camera-based systems utilize visual information to browse. LiDAR is generally considered more accurate and reliable in low-light conditions.
